Microsoft Office Products for Mac

Microsoft Office for Mac: Many people still don't realize that Microsoft Office fully integrates with the Mac. Documents sent to you from a PC will open and document you create on your Mac and send to PC users will open on their computer.

Office for Mac includes Microsoft Word, Excel, Powerpoint, and Entourage (the Mac version of Outlook)

Apple iWork

Apple iWork: Designed by Apple and better than Microsoft Office. Microsoft's upcoming 2008 version of Office for the Mac copies Apple iWork in every way. Everything you create in iWork can be saved as a Microsoft Office document to send to PC users. iWork includes Pages (replaces your need for Word), Keynote (use this instead of Powerpoint), and Numbers (no need for Excel).
